擅长:python、mysql、java
<p>除了其他人所说的之外,您可能还想知道<code>in</code>所做的是调用<code>list.__contains__</code>方法,您可以在编写的任何类上定义该方法,并且可以非常方便地充分使用python。</p>
<p>默认用途可能是:</p>
<pre><code>>>> class ContainsEverything:
def __init__(self):
return None
def __contains__(self, *elem, **k):
return True
>>> a = ContainsEverything()
>>> 3 in a
True
>>> a in a
True
>>> False in a
True
>>> False not in a
False
>>>
</code></pre>